> Can I please get a review of these change which removes the outdated use of > `jdk.internal.javac.ParticipatesInPreview` and the qualified export of > `jdk.internal.javac` package? This addresses > https://bugs.openjdk.org/browse/JDK-8365533. > > These qualified exports in `java.base` were added in > https://bugs.openjdk.org/browse/JDK-8308753 when ClassFile API was in > preview. Starting Java 24, ClassFile API is now a part of Java SE. These > affected modules don't use any other preview feature, so there's no longer a > need to export the `jdk.internal.javac` package to these modules. > > tier1, tier2 and tier3 testing of this change completed without any related > failures. > See also #26765 ([JDK‑8365416](https://bugs.openjdk.org/browse/JDK-8365416)) Right, that's what prompted me to start looking into this.
